Результаты исследований обучающихся в проекте "Алгоритмы"

Материал из Wiki Mininuniver
Перейти к навигацииПерейти к поиску


Авторы и участники проекта

Шокшинская-Малышева Злата

Садакова Анна

Команда Ритмик

Тема исследования группы

Алгоритмы используемые для сортировки больших массивов данных

Проблемный вопрос (вопрос для исследования)

Как алгоритмы упрощают жизнь?

Цели исследования

1. Познакомиться с понятием алгоритмы

2.Выяснить какие бывают виды алгоритмов

3.Определить какие алгоритмы наиболее эффективны для сортировки больших массивов данных

4.Создать ментальную карту на тему алгоритмы сортировки

Результаты проведённого исследования

Исследование показало, что для сортировки больших массивов данных наиболее эффективными являются алгоритмы сортировки, которые выполняются за линейное время, такие как поразрядная сортировка и сортировка подсчетом. Они позволяют эффективно обрабатывать большие объемы данных без необходимости хранить все данные в памяти.

Быстрая сортировка и сортировка слиянием также являются эффективными алгоритмами сортировки, но они требуют больше памяти для выполнения и могут быть менее эффективными для больших объемов данных.

Наивные алгоритмы сортировки, такие как сортировка пузырьком и сортировка вставками, не рекомендуется использовать для сортировки больших массивов данных, так как они неэффективны и могут занимать много времени на выполнение.

Таким образом, для сортировки больших массивов данных рекомендуется использовать алгоритмы сортировки, которые выполняются за линейное время, такие как поразрядная сортировка и сортировка подсчетом. Быстрая сортировка и сортировка слиянием также могут быть использованы, но они требуют больше памяти и могут быть менее эффективными для больших объемов данных.

Вывод

Полезные ресурсы

Другие документы